Detailed Description
The technical solutions in the embodiments of the present invention will be clearly and completely described below with reference to the dr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ments; based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Example (b):
the information computer support arm support provided by figures 1-4 comprises a base 1, a rotating arm 3, a support arm 9 and an operating panel 6, a groove 2 is arranged on the front side of the base 1, the inside of the groove 2 is provided with a rotating shaft, one end of the rotating arm 3 is connected to the rotating shaft, the other end of the rotating arm 3 is connected to a connecting seat 4 in a rotating manner, the connecting seat 4 is fixedly connected to the back side of the support arm 9, the lower end of the support arm 9 is provided with a connecting plate 8, the end part of the connecting plate 8 is connected to a support plate 7 in a rotating manner through an articulated element, the operating panel 6 is fixedly installed on the support plate 7 through screws, and a bearing component used for fixing a display screen 12 is arranged on the support arm 9.
The bearing assembly comprises a sliding seat 91, a bearing plate 92, a fastening nut 93 and screws 94, two sliding chutes 10 are vertically arranged on the supporting arm 9, the sliding chutes 10 longitudinally penetrate through the supporting arm 9, the two screws 94 are arranged on the inner side surface of the sliding seat 91, one ends of the two screws 94 respectively penetrate through the two sliding chutes 10, the fastening nut 93 is in threaded connection with the screws 94, and the bearing plate 92 is fixedly connected on the outer side surface of the sliding seat 91; by adjusting the fixing positions of the two screws 94 on the sliding chute 10, the height of the bearing plate 92 can be adjusted, so that the height of the display screen 12 can be adjusted, and the use by a user is facilitated. Be equipped with four engaging lugs 921 on the loading board 92, four engaging lugs 921 are the periphery of annular array form distribution at loading board 92, are equipped with the fixed orifices 922 of fixed display screen 12 on the engaging lug 921, adopt four engaging lugs 921 fixed display screen 12 for more stable of the installation of display screen 12.
A side of the lower part of the supporting arm 9 is provided with a storage frame 5, the storage frame 5 is installed on the supporting arm 9 through a fixing band, vertical notches are formed in the side of the storage frame 5, and articles placed in the storage frame 5 can be taken out by a user.
The other side of the lower part of the supporting arm 9 is provided with a clamping plate 11, and one side of the clamping plate 11 is provided with a clamping protrusion for accommodating the bearing plate 92.
The direction of rotation of the hinge is 90 degrees, i.e., the range of rotation of the carrier plate 92 is horizontal to vertical.
The upper end face front side of operation panel 6 is equipped with blotter 61, and blotter 61 is elastic material and makes, and elastic material is rubber, and the corner of blotter 61 is the fillet setting.
The working principle is as follows:
the utility model provides an information computer support arm support, when using, through fixing the wall with base 1, reuse rotor arm 3 with base 1 and support arm 9 rotation connection, fix the display screen 12 of computer on the loading board 92 of support arm 9, make the computer in the use, display screen 12 can freely turn to, simultaneously, keyboard and mouse can be placed on operation panel 6, convenient to use; when not using, can upwards rotate 90 degrees with operation panel 6 for operation panel 6 card is on cardboard 11, is close to the wall with display screen and the rotation of support arm 9, accomodates the convenience, reduces the occupation space of computer when not using.
